Reacting to challenges that have been observed in human-computerinteraction (HCI) education, as well as the multidisciplinary design, science, and engineering underpinnings, we investigate a pedagogical approach based on case methods. Our study of various case method techniques in an undergraduate HCI class provides insights into challenges that can be expected in the employment of case methods, student learning outcomes, and considerations for HCI curriculum planning. In general, case methods show great promise with a wide variety of topics, and we present broad recommendations for future work that will improve integration of HCI professional practice, research, and education.

This paper proposes a fast and robust framework for incrementally detecting text on road signs from natural scene video. The new framework makes two main contributions. First, the framework applies a Divide-and-Conquer strategy to decompose the original task into two sub-tasks, that is, localization of road signs and detection of text. The algorithms for the two sub-tasks are smoothly incorporated into a unified framework through a real time tracking algorithm. Second, the framework provides a novel way for text detection from video by integrating 2D features in each video frame (e.g., color, edges, texture) with 3D information available in a video sequence (e.g., object structure). The feasibility of the proposed framework has been evaluated on the video sequences captured from a moving vehicle. The new framework can be applied to a driving assistant system and other tasks of text detection from video.

In spoken dialogue applications dialogue management has conventionally been realized with a single monolithic dialogue manager implementing a comprehensive dialogue control model. We present a highly distributed system structure that enables the integration of different dialogue control approaches to handle spoken dialogues. With this structure it is possible to integrate multiple dialogue control models into a single working application in a flexible fashion. The main principle is that all the processing is distributed into many compact agents that focus on single tasks. The agents process the information independently and share all the information via shared information storage. We present the principles that enable such distribution. In addition, a multilingual example application, AthosMail, is presented.

Evaluating distributed CSCW applications is a difficult endeavor. Frameworks and methodologies for structuring this type of evaluation have become a central concern for CSCW researchers. In this paper we describe the problems involved in evaluating remote collaborations, and we review some of the more prominent conceptual frameworks of group interaction that have driven CSCW evaluation in the past. A multifaceted evaluation framework is presented that approaches the problem from the relationships underlying joint awareness, communication, collaboration, coordination, and work coupling. Finally, recommendations for carrying out multifaceted evaluations of remote interaction are provided. Copyright 2004 ACM.

Many failures in long-term collaboration occur because of a lack of activity awareness. Activity awareness is a broad concept that involves awareness of synchronous and asynchronous interactions over extended time periods. We describe a procedure to evaluate activity awareness and collaborative activities in a controlled setting. The activities used are modeled on real-world collaborations documented earlier in a field study. We developed an experimental method to study these activity awareness problems in the laboratory. Participants worked on a simulated long-term project in the laboratory over multiple experimental sessions with a confederate, who partially scripted activities and probes. We present evidence showing that this method represents a valid model of real collaboration, based on participants' active engagement, lively negotiation, and awareness difficulties. We found that having the ability to define, reproduce, and systematically manipulate collaborative situations allowed us to assess the effect of realistic conditions on activity awareness in remote collaboration.
